Chapter 1

After giving birth early, memories from a different life flooded into my mind.

In these memories, the daughter I had worked so hard to bring into the world was switched with hers. After that, I was told that my daughter had a congenital heart condition.

I worked hard to raise her for eighteen years. In the end, I sold off all my assets so that she could have a heart transplant. Meanwhile, I had collapsed from all my efforts to care for her.

Left with no choice, I wanted to tell my “daughter” that I was leaving this world, but I overheard her talking with my best friend.

“That fool still thinks I’m her daughter. I was the one who poisoned her! Mom, once she dies and you get rid of that pretender, we can finally be together again!”

That was when I found out my daughter had been swapped out, and that I had been giving my all to the perpetrator.

When I next opened my eyes, pain radiated from my belly, and a nurse said, “Miss Scott, we’ve just learned that your daughter has a congenital heart condition.”

I had secretly sent someone off to help me carry out a maternity test.

The results proved conclusively that Agnes Beckett was not my daughter.

While acting unmoved, I had someone search for my actual daughter. At the same time, I stopped paying the fees for Agnes’ incubator.

My husband, Hadrian Beckett, arrived before my best friend, Liza Blair.

He held Agnes in his arms as he rushed into my ward. She was having difficulty breathing, and her face was turning blue.

“Are you insane, Rowena? You know that Aggie has heart problems, but you stopped paying her medical fees? Are you trying to kill her?”

I was just about to show him the maternity report and tell him that our baby had been switched. But when I glanced up and took a good look at his face, I was stunned.

Why had I never once suspected that Aggie was not my child in the previous timeline?

It was because she had looked so much like Hadrian.

Everyone said that daughters took after their fathers, and I had thought the same.

Yet, when I looked at the man I had been through so much with, I only felt a cold sensation starting up from my extremities.

I lowered my voice, and it shook as I said, “I talked to the doctor. Her chances of getting better from this condition are tiny. Even if we spend a fortune to treat her, she will always be weak and reliant on medical intervention. Her life will be painful. It would be better to… end things while she’s still young and innocent. She’ll suffer less that way.”

When Hadrian understood what I meant, he immediately yelled shrilly, “How could you be so heartless, Rowena? This is our daughter! The doctor already said that she has a chance as long as we’re willing to pay for it! Besides…”

Hadrian paused before resuming, “Didn’t your father leave you a lot of money? You’re saving your own daughter here. Don’t tell me you can’t bear to spend this money?”

My gaze sharpened. Ah, so this was the reason they had switched the babies.

Hadrian wanted me to spend my money to treat the daughter he had with his lover. He even expected me to expend all my time and effort to care for her.

In the previous timeline, I had been thoroughly fooled. Ignorant of the truth, that was exactly what I had done.

In the end, I had sacrificed all my money, my health, and even my life in exchange for their happy family.

I gave him a rueful smile. “Well, you’re right about that. If you want to treat her condition so badly, then you should spend your money to do it.”

I could not be bothered to look at him any longer. I turned around, intent on lying back in bed.

Just then, Agnes started crying. It was such perfect timing.

Hadrian seemed to find a great way to guilt me. Loudly, he announced, “Listen, the baby’s crying! She’s looking for her mother! You’re her mother, Rowena. How could you abandon her just because she’s a little sick? Are you so heartless?”

The ward door opened again. The nurse stopped at the door in the middle of doing her rounds, her unsure, judging, gaze stopping on me.
